Chapter #06 - Taking a Bite of the Jawbreaker
Busy times - as the unforgettable Courtney Shayne, roles in Ready to Rumble, The Last Stop, Monkeybone, and playing Moira in Strange Hearts.
Rose McGowan next took on the starring role of Courtney Shayne in the dark teen comedy
Jawbreaker (1999). The role still remains one of Rose’s personal favorites: "I love Courtney Shayne, she was hilarious. She was very misunderstood. People said she was so evil and I say, ‘Well, she was just a
sociopath.’”
Jawbreaker gained Rose many new fans and an MTV Movie Award nomination for Best Villain. She also had a role as the dead rock goddess Sno Blo in
Sleeping Beauties, a short film.
After taking some time off from the movies to be with her fiancé, Rose couldn’t seem to find roles that really challenged her. In 2000 she was seen in supporting roles in Ready to Rumble and The Last Stop. She next had small roles in Monkeybone and The Killing Yard before starring in as the vulnerable and confused Moira Kennedy in Strange Hearts. Although none of these movies were great successes in terms of box office or critical response, they once again proved Rose’s versatility as an actress and her great charisma. "Yep, I have made some bad films”, she admitted. “But unlike Kate Hudson or Gwyneth Paltrow I didn't grow up in Hollywood, with stability and wealth and all my needs were catered to. I came here trying to survive. I couldn't afford to make worthy, artistic movies for no money. I had to pay the rent.”
